Output d52d3bc31e73e54bd4a72d118e7dbc7ef8a4f2385ddba77219e9ce925cb39796:1

value
323750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3ec1e3a971c105127b8d0e33cf30b539f358aa OP_EQUAL
address
A8Qt6RGhXbvCnvJbTbS6AMiJH2voCZrvM4
transaction
d52d3bc31e73e54bd4a72d118e7dbc7ef8a4f2385ddba77219e9ce925cb39796